## Tuning

FeeCrafter's rules engine decides shipping fees per order, and yes, the defaults are opinionated. If a merchant on the Parcelgrove plan complains about weird surcharges, it's almost always one of the knobs below rather than a bug. Changing a value takes effect on the next rule reload, so no restart needed — just don't crank the distance multiplier without checking with eng. Current defaults follow.

tuning table, kageg-kagap:
CAPS = {
    "druox": 842,
    "quenax": 605,
    "zormir": 107,
    "tamwyn": 577,
    "kasok": 688,
}

Subject: Handover — Queueforge migration

Hi Tomas, handing this off before I'm out. We're replacing the homegrown job queue (the infamous "Bucketline") with Queueforge across the Orvale services. Cutover branch is `qf-migrate`; the shim keeps old job payloads readable, so review that adapter carefully — it's where the dragons live. Rollback is just the feature flag, nothing fancy. Deploys to the worker fleet go through the new pipeline, which verifies artifacts against the signing key below.

rollout seal: bky4_yke3

Action item from the Paystream postmortem: the export switched from fixed-width to delimited without bumping the format version, and downstream Ledgerbird parsed garbage for two cycles. Fix is up for review — it adds an explicit format header plus a validator that rejects mismatched versions before upload. Reviewer, please check the validator covers the legacy fixed-width files too; we still get those from two older clients. Test fixtures for both formats and the rollout checklist are on the export-format page.

runbook for badug-kadup: https://confluence.zemvarlabs.internal/projects/browse/display/projects/bd1b